Tips on Applying for a Loan

The Kansas Association of Mortgage Professionals (KAMP) encourages consumers meet with a registered mortgage professional working for a licensed mortgage broker company when beginning the loan application process, whether refinancing, consolidating debt or purchasing a new home.

Additionally, KAMP recommends that consumers consider the following tips prior to moving forward with the mortgage process:
  1. Be aware of all fees and closing costs that you will incur. It is important to understand that financing a mortgage is not free. Consumers need to ask their mortgage originator to provide, in writing, all costs that will be incurred in order to complete the process.
  2. Understand the new program that you are getting into. If, when refinancing, your old loan was a “fixed” program and your new loan is “adjustable,” make sure you have a clear understanding of how much your new monthly mortgage payment will be, and the exact period of time that the monthly payment is good for.
  3. Determine exactly how much your monthly payment will be reduced. Consumers should compare the total remaining payments of their existing loan to the total payments required on the new loan request plus closing costs to determine the actual savings.
  4. Shop and Compare. Consumers should call two or three originators to compare interest rates and the total cost of closing to the terms offered by their current lender.
  5. Ask how long the offered rate is good for. Whatever rate or term your mortgage originator offers, be sure to get the information in writing, and also ask for a written guarantee of how long that rate is good for, i.e. 30 days, 45 days, etc.
  6. Ask about the credentials of your mortgage originator. Ask your mortgage originator if they are a member of the Kansas Association of Mortgage Professionals, whose members adhere to a strict code of ethics. You may also want to consider whether your loan officer is a Certified Residential Mortgage Specialist or a Certified Mortgage Consultant.
